Portage is a package management system used by Gentoo Linux
# ChangeLog for app-text/highlight
# Copyright 1999-2008 Gentoo Foundation; Distributed under the GPL v2
# $Header: /var/cvsroot/gentoo-x86/app-text/highlight/ChangeLog,v 1.23 2008/06/19 17:04:43 ken69267 Exp $
19 Jun 2008; Kenneth Prugh
amd64 stable, bug #226657
18 Jun 2008; Friedrich Oslage
highlight-2.6.10.ebuild:
stable on sparc, bug #226657
17 Jun 2008; Christian Faulhammer
highlight-2.6.10.ebuild:
stable x86, bug 226657
14 Jun 2008; nixnut
Stable on ppc wrt bug 226657
26 May 2008; Samuli Suominen
Desktop entry with icon.
*highlight-2.6.10 (23 May 2008)
23 May 2008; Samuli Suominen
+files/highlight-2.6.10-conf_dir.patch, +highlight-2.6.10.ebuild:
Version bump. Move filetypes.conf back to where it belongs wrt #222751,
thanks to Jeroen Roovers.
05 May 2008; Samuli Suominen
Replace CFLAGS with CXXFLAGS since it's g++ we are calling.
*highlight-2.6.9 (04 May 2008)
04 May 2008; Samuli Suominen
+files/highlight-2.6.9-asneeded.patch, +files/highlight-2.6.9-gcc43.patch,
+highlight-2.6.9.ebuild:
Version bump with GCC 4.3 and -Wl,--as-needed patch by Peter Alfredsen.
16 Apr 2008; Jeroen Roovers
Marked ~hppa too.
06 Sep 2007; Steve Dibb
amd64 stable
26 Jun 2007; Gustavo Zacarias
highlight-2.4.8.ebuild:
Stable on sparc
24 May 2007; Gustavo Zacarias
highlight-2.4.8.ebuild:
Keyworded ~sparc wrt #129395
06 Apr 2007; Tobias Scherbaum
highlight-2.4.8.ebuild:
ppc stable, bug #129395
12 Mar 2007; Leonardo Boshell
Replacing text-markup herd with the new sgml and tex herds.
03 Mar 2007; nixnut
Added ~ppc wrt bug 129395
02 Mar 2007; Raúl Porcel
x86 stable wrt bug 129395
21 Feb 2007; Piotr Jaroszyński
Transition to Manifest2.
*highlight-2.4.8 (03 Feb 2007)
03 Feb 2007; Simon Stelling
version bump and add ~amd64; bug 154789
09 Mar 2006; Martin Ehmsen
Removed unnecessary S=${WORKDIR}/${P}
03 Dec 2005; Andrej Kacian
Stable on x86, bug #114323.
03 Dec 2005;
Used ${P} instead of ${PN}-${PV}
*highlight-2.4.3 (03 Dec 2005)
03 Dec 2005;
Version bump
*highlight-2.2.9 (26 Mar 2005)
26 Mar 2005;
Initial ebuild, contributed by Jan Nárovec
AUX highlight-2.6.10-conf_dir.patch 329 RMD160 50a49bbf4a4a4c24d9ca8684b9c369be1ec73910 SHA1 c4bb01c87ba5c3b87e8e285355cb8199b8d537db SHA256 d9134b57851def3a42d1779354b7507bed351ebf7e84b9947a46e0bcf19d4136
AUX highlight-2.6.9-asneeded.patch 946 RMD160 f45810d93d5c7365e055fe5735c3f76d7a1616a3 SHA1 11048d411034566477b64a9c3e283ac263874cf3 SHA256 a4ef2fd6e4429e1e9a492b20fdebae50252074cc0cee53e7278eee60bf08cf49
AUX highlight-2.6.9-gcc43.patch 492 RMD160 37c2907fd2b0f008175865980bdf1d966e23e803 SHA1 6cef4b90567229ad2b9041462736545e397fdbd2 SHA256 f75e28b9d8cf299ee7cf3fbd38db340343225a3badf950423810bf400da050a0
DIST highlight-2.4.8.tar.bz2 315760 RMD160 a2623a2f5102fae1d9f5712a504876a55eda9c81 SHA1 091689fde96c9f4e3de75ea1b7c1838e8d25708c SHA256 e661b347222e5701930c697ff74c17ad8d65166bf34cb72b2041bb2e2e9c9aec
DIST highlight-2.6.10.tar.bz2 397860 RMD160 20cfb4a142a4297da25e37e1b8a404bc9ea98376 SHA1 8b4fe442a7591ae9fe97a94ff6fc0930edc25e39 SHA256 2a47ba938e3eb06e6f11b503c216e5e732508feccf468215b8b44b75539cc2a1
EBUILD highlight-2.4.8.ebuild 628 RMD160 f79ada21302c8907e1a09fa863682a32ee8592db SHA1 1e3054b7d36fdbaaafb954f7486f87f73852d43c SHA256 3e82142ddfe8b8af3ccdadbacaf9cfd3d3ec1bade8c3d668c057e3b30d83879b
EBUILD highlight-2.6.10.ebuild 1422 RMD160 352717cfb95a7a1852f40a76442c91b0598cb025 SHA1 5ff78b200ad05eb2f94baf491020aeb68fda87ff SHA256 16d5ac614ac4f24288b42ca191d3f0eda21ff9229b1bc80d954bf7a058a3354e
MISC ChangeLog 3060 RMD160 9ca70e4ca15273f7c73f593502b597a5894a1291 SHA1 8005f67ec64ee227ffd055eb9b9829b0ed0c5352 SHA256 79e6360aa95be05b4590521e62775d3b2c507bc9b946e732b3474fbc5a462e06
MISC metadata.xml 178 RMD160 7a7e1fa5fc747be92ff6d87c7e43c2909bf3c5d7 SHA1 6f35e3eb98d5da19aa894ba2478aabb2698037c6 SHA256 d0798c610b068ab759a9ecfa6fedaa735750e718c770783216ad5ea76e0020ba
# Copyright 1999-2008 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
# $Header: /var/cvsroot/gentoo-x86/app-text/highlight/highlight-2.4.8.ebuild,v 1.9 2008/05/04 20:41:59 drac Exp $
DESCRIPTION="converts source code to formatted text ((X)HTML, RTF, (La)TeX,
XSL-FO, XML) with syntax highlight"
HOMEPAGE="http://www.andre-simon.de/"
SRC_URI="http://www.andre-simon.de/zip/${P}.tar.bz2"
LICENSE="GPL-2"
SLOT="0"
KEYWORDS="amd64 ~hppa ppc sparc x86"
IUSE=""
src_compile() {
make -f makefile || die
}
src_install() {
DESTDIR=${D} bin_dir=${D}/usr/bin make -f makefile -e install || die
}
# Copyright 1999-2008 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
# $Header: /var/cvsroot/gentoo-x86/app-text/highlight/highlight-2.6.10.ebuild,v 1.6 2008/06/19 17:04:43 ken69267 Exp $
WX_GTK_VER=2.6
inherit wxwidgets eutils toolchain-funcs
DESCRIPTION="converts source code to formatted text ((X)HTML, RTF, (La)TeX, XSL-FO, XML) with syntax highlight"
HOMEPAGE="http://www.andre-simon.de"
SRC_URI="http://www.andre-simon.de/zip/${P}.tar.bz2"
LICENSE="GPL-2"
SLOT="0"
KEYWORDS="amd64 ~hppa ppc sparc x86"
IUSE="wxwindows"
DEPEND="wxwindows? ( =x11-libs/wxGTK-2.6* )"
src_unpack() {
unpack ${A}
cd "${S}"
epatch "${FILESDIR}"/${PN}-2.6.9-gcc43.patch \
"${FILESDIR}"/${PN}-2.6.9-asneeded.patch \
"${FILESDIR}"/${P}-conf_dir.patch
sed -i \
-e "s:-O2::" \
-e "s:CFLAGS:CXXFLAGS:g" \
src/makefile || die "sed failed."
}
src_compile() {
emake -f makefile CXX="$(tc-getCXX)" all || die "emake all failed."
if use wxwindows; then
need-wxwidgets ansi
emake -f makefile CXX="$(tc-getCXX)" all-gui || die "emake all-gui failed."
fi
}
src_install() {
dodir /usr/bin
emake -f makefile \
DESTDIR="${D}" \
install || die "emake install failed."
if use wxwindows; then
emake -f makefile \
DESTDIR="${D}" \
install-gui || die "emake install-gui failed."
doicon src/gui/${PN}.xpm
make_desktop_entry ${PN}-gui Highlight ${PN} "Utility;TextTools"
fi
}